The jungles of Brazil are filled with intrigue, undiscovered mysteries, and dangers.  Aerocopters Internationalè, an aircraft charter service, is hired by Carl Jennings to help him in his quest to uncover the mysteries of two hidden cities, buried deep in the jungles.  During the exploration and subsequent finds, one of the helicopters crash, leaving the three survivors to fend for them selves until they are rescued.

            Within weeks, Aerocopters Internationalè, known by the CIA for their unique mission capabilities is contacted, asking for help in a planned rescue mission of two known survivors, whose jet was shot down deep inside Brazil's drug cartel territory.

            A dramatic and destructive plan comes together as does the possibility that the archeological explorations, the Brazilian Drug Cartel, and the KGB may somehow be related- and that included the crash. But how did they know about the discoveries and why were they so interested in them?  What secrets lay buried within the forgotten cities and why would people be killed for them?

In the end, man is his own destiny, and in searching for answers one must be cautious, for the answers one seeks can be lost as quickly as they are found.
